## Onboarding: Farebranch Rules Engine

Plugin authors integrate with Farebranch by registering fee rules against the evaluation API. Rules are sandboxed; they cannot perform network calls directly. All rate-table lookups go through the host, which validates your plugin manifest at load time. Your local env file must include the signing credential the host uses to verify manifests, set on the next line.

secret setting of bajef-fajof: COURIER_KEY3=76c

## SquatSniff — Account Recovery (runbook fragment)

New contractor? Welcome. SquatSniff is our typo-squatting package scanner, and yes, the admin account locks itself weirdly often. Don't create a fresh account — findings history is tied to the original. Run the recovery flow from the bastion, confirm with your lead, and when the console asks, supply the recovery passphrase below.

unlock words, kajeg-fahif: holmir-casael-novdor

# Data Stores Overview — Quotastone Service

Quotastone tracks per-tenant rate quotas for all Lanternbay APIs. Quota counters live in a sharded key-value tier, while tenant plan definitions and override records sit in a relational store. Support staff can read (but not modify) quota tables directly when investigating throttling complaints. Counters reset hourly; plan changes propagate within two minutes. If a tenant reports 429s despite an upgraded plan, check the overrides table first. To inspect it, connect with the read-only string below.

primary connection of yagep-kahip = redis://giliel_svc:zYiKsLL2PLpfPL@db-348f.xolmarsys.corp:5432/fenwyn